podman rmi should only untag image if parent of another
podman rmi was deleting an image even if it was a parent of another image. This fix just untags the image instead. This also fixes podman rmi to remove intermediate images of an image when the image is removed. Signed-off-by: umohnani8 <umohnani@redhat.com> Closes: #1055 Approved by: mheon
